Seeking New York by Tom Miller

Beautifully illustrated with line drawings and photographs, engagingly presented, and richly detailed, this charming guide traces the architectural and social history of Manhattan one building at a time

Tom Miller moved to New York City in 1979 from Dayton, Ohio, where his interest in architecture and history was sparked. Tom currently holds the rank of Inspector within the NYPD's Auxiliary Police Force. For years his involvement with the New York Police Department' whether on patrol or marching its wide avenues - has afforded him the opportunity to see the city's seemingly endless variety of buildings. He started the blog Daytonian in Manhattan in 2009, and since then he has investigated and researched the stories of more than a thousand Manhattan buildings. He urges New Yorkers and visitors alike to 'never stop being a tourist' and 'never stop looking up'.
